Front
What are sight words?
Back
Sight words are commonly used words that children are encouraged to recognize without having to sound them out. They are often high-frequency words that appear frequently in texts.

Front
Why are sight words important in reading?
Back
Sight words are important because they help children read more fluently and with greater comprehension. Recognizing these words quickly allows readers to focus on understanding the meaning of the text rather than decoding individual words.

Front
What is the difference between sight words and phonetic words?
Back
Sight words are memorized for instant recognition, while phonetic words are decoded using phonics rules.
